Moving from Olympia, WA, to Grand Rapids, MI, runs anywhere from $1,291 for a DIY rental-truck move of a small home up to $12,835 for full-service movers handling a larger 4 - 5 bedroom household. The two cities sit about 2,137 miles apart, and a move on this route usually takes 6 to 17 days door to door. Use our moving cost calculator to compare estimates and options for your specific move.

There are 3 main ways to move from Olympia to Grand Rapids: full-service movers, moving containers, and rental trucks. Full-service is the most expensive but covers everything from labor to transportation, with a 2-3 bedroom move on this route averaging $4,095 - $9,242. Containers cost roughly 30% less than full-service for the same home size, and rental trucks run about 60% less, though loading is on you with either DIY option. At 2,137 miles, expect 6 to 17 days in transit no matter which service you choose.

Full-service moving costs from Olympia, WA to Grand Rapids, MI

For the 2,137-mile move from Olympia, Washington, to Grand Rapids, Michigan, full-service movers cost between $3,051 and $12,835. A long-distance moving company takes care of loading, hauling, and unloading. For an added cost of $314 - $2,096 (1 - 5+ bedrooms), crews will pack your boxes. The weight of your shipment and the mileage between the two cities are what drive your final cost. For scale, local movers in Olympia generally start around $296 plus $133 per hour, per mover.

Here's a breakdown of full-service moving costs by home size from Olympia to Grand Rapids:

  • Studio apartment / 1 bedroom: $3,051 - $6,404
  • 2 - 3 bedrooms: $4,095 - $9,242
  • 4+ bedrooms: $7,835 - $12,835

Moving container costs from Olympia, WA to Grand Rapids, MI

Moving containers from Olympia, Washington, to Grand Rapids, Michigan, cost between $1,658 and $6,237. You load everything on your own schedule (U-Haul gives you 3 days and PODS gives you 30). When you're ready, the company takes care of getting the container from point A to point B. Need more time than that? Extra storage in Olympia typically runs around $100/month.

Take a look at moving container pricing by home size from Olympia to Grand Rapids:

  • Studio apartment / 1 bedroom: $1,658 - $3,322
  • 2 - 3 bedrooms: $2,214 - $4,660
  • 4+ bedrooms: $3,097 - $6,237

What other costs come with moving containers?

  • Moving labor: Containers are self-loaded, so many people hire hourly help for the heavy lifting. moveBuddha data shows two movers for about five hours runs around $734 in Olympia, WA. Compare the best labor-only movers nationwide
  • Added contents protection: If you want stronger coverage than the default liability, full-value protection is the upgrade to consider. Most providers charge 1% - 2% of your shipment value, roughly $500 - $1,000 for $50,000 in contents.
  • Storage: After the first month, rental fees average $79 per month for a small 7- to 8-foot container and $157 per month for a larger 12- to 16-foot unit.
  • Access: If you anticipate needing to access items while in storage, confirm there's a facility conveniently located near your Grand Rapids, MI, destination before booking.

Moving truck rental costs from Olympia, WA to Grand Rapids, MI

Renting a moving truck for the 2,137-mile move from Olympia, Washington, to Grand Rapids, Michigan, costs between $1,291 and $3,740, before these typical add-ons:

  • Fuel for the drive: $713 - $814
  • Daily insurance: $31/day
  • Equipment rentals: $7 - $21
  • Olympia daily rental rate: $19 - $39
  • Per-mile fee beyond your free allowance: $1.09 - $1.59
Home sizeTypical truck size
Studio / 1 bedroom10 - 12 ft
2 - 3 bedrooms15 - 17 ft
4+ bedrooms20 - 26 ft (typically requires diesel)

These are typical moving truck rental costs from Olympia to Grand Rapids based on home size:

  • Studio apartment / 1 bedroom: $1,291 - $2,342
  • 2 - 3 bedrooms: $1,411 - $2,817
  • 4+ bedrooms: $1,762 - $3,740

Pro tip: The base rate of $1,291 - $3,740 is just the starting point for a rental truck move from Olympia to Grand Rapids. Fuel ($713 - $814) , lodging at around $157/night, meals, and equipment rentals are all on top of that. Factor in an extra $600 - $1,200 to get a realistic picture of what the move will actually cost.

What other costs come with rental trucks?

  • Moving labor: Rental trucks don't come with loaders. Hiring 2 movers in Olympia, Washington, for roughly 5 hours usually costs about $734.
  • Gas: Fuel costs total $713 - $814 for the 2,137-mile drive, depending on whether your truck takes gas or diesel.
  • Equipment: Appliance dollies, auto transport trailers, and furniture pads are separate rentals. Expect to spend between $63 and $341, depending on what you need.
  • Additional insurance: Daily coverage upgrades typically add around $30.
  • Lodging: Budget around $157 per night for hotel stops on the 2,137-mile drive. With 2 - 3 overnight stops, total lodging typically costs $314 - $472.

Freight trailer costs from Olympia, WA to Grand Rapids, MI

Freight trailers are a solid option for larger DIY moves from Olympia, Washington, to Grand Rapids, Michigan. Standard trailers run 28 feet long, and you're only charged for the portion you actually fill. The carrier drops the trailer off, you load it at your own pace, and they handle the drive to your new city.

Pricing is based entirely on the linear footage your shipment occupies, not the full trailer length. Most long-distance freight moves land somewhere between $943 and $3,617.

Take a look at freight trailer costs based on home size for moves from Olympia to Grand Rapids:

  • Studio apartment / 1 bedroom: $1,493 - $3,020
  • 2 - 3 bedrooms: $1,861 - $3,617
  • 4+ bedrooms: $2,503 - $4,791

Pro tip: Loading a freight trailer is a bit different from filling a container. The 4-foot ramp can be steep with large items, and getting the most out of 8 feet of vertical clearance takes planning. Since pricing is based on linear feet used, every inch of wasted space has a cost.

What other costs come with freight trailers?

  • Moving labor: Freight trailers don't include loading help. In Olympia, Washington, hiring 2 movers for about 5 hours typically costs $734.
  • More space: You only pay for the trailer footage you use, but underestimating your load can add roughly $79 - $157 per additional foot to your total.
  • Time of year: Rates tend to climb during peak moving season (mid-May through mid-September) when trailer demand is at its highest.

FAQs: Moving from Olympia, WA, to Grand Rapids, MI

What is the best time of year to move from Olympia, WA to Grand Rapids, MI?

Aim for a move between October and March, when demand drops and rates tend to be lower across all service types. Peak season runs mid-May through mid-September, and weekends and month-end dates are pricier regardless of season. A midweek, mid-month date outside peak season is your best bet for saving money.

How long does a move from Olympia, WA to Grand Rapids, MI take?

Full-service movers and container companies typically complete this route in 5 - 7 days, since carriers consolidate shipments heading the same direction. Freight trailers are usually the fastest option outside of driving yourself, with deliveries in 3 - 5 days, though you'll need to be ready to receive your shipment on arrival. Driving a rental truck yourself puts the schedule entirely in your hands.

What extra costs come with a truck rental on this route?

The base rate only covers the vehicle. Expect to add fuel ($713 - $814), daily insurance ($31/day), and equipment rentals ($7 - $21) on top. Overnight stops can add another $157/night for lodging if your drive spans more than a day.
